FLEA MARKETS


The New Meadowlands Flea Market is located in
the heart of Bergen County in The Meadowlands
Sports Complex, Plaza J, East Rutherford, New Jersey.
Originally opened in 1991 as the Meadowlands Flea
Market, we are under new management as of March
2010 and are dedicated in bringing you a wonderful
shopping and buying experience.
Renamed, the New Meadowlands Market, we thank our loyal
customers for their continued patronage and welcome new
customers graciously. State Fair Event Management is located in
Belleville, New Jersey and welcomes the return of Bob Brumale, as
manager of the new marketplace. Bob was a founding member of the
original flea market and like State Fair is devoted to providing a positive
shopping and buying experience to all of our customers and to our vendors.
Open Saturdays, Special Event Days and Holidays from 8 AM to 4 PM,
you will find hundreds of merchandise vendors along with delicious food,
free entertainment and games. As always admission and parking are FREE.
The Meadowlands Sports Complex is conveniently located where Route 3 and the New Jersey Turnpike meet, easily accessible to all major highways. The San Jose Flea Market, located in the heart of the Silicon Valley, was founded by George Bumb Sr. in March 1960. His idea to open a flea market sparked while working in the solid waste and landfill business. He witnessed an abundance of treasures thrown away every day and realized he could make a profit from these discarded items. After visiting swap meets in Los Angeles and Paris’ Thieves Market for inspiration, George Bumb Sr. established the San Jose Flea Market on 1590 Berryessa Road in San Jose, California. He bought 120 acres (0.49 km2) of an old meat-processing plant and remodeled it to create a market with an initial 20 vendors and only 100 customers per day. Now, the San Jose Flea Market is the largest open-air market in the U.S. and has become a California landmark with over four million visitors each year .

Puerto Vallarta Flea Market
Everything you want in one place! The Flea Market is the place to find everything you were looking for but couldn't find elsewhere. Covering an entire city block, this was originally the town's "supermarket"...stalls of farm-fresh vegetables, butcher shops, fruit vendors, grain suppliers, and stores selling everything a house could need. As tourism developed, the town grew, and a supermarket opened just across the river, accessible by foot-bridge. The market began seeing more tourists than locals, and it has become what you see today: a huge bustling marketplace for arts, handicrafts, and the more mass-produced items that every tourist needs one or two of.
